R&B/soul subsidiary of Motown Records. Notable artists included The Velvelettes, The Spinners, The Monitors, The Elgins and Chris Clark. VIP went on to put out nearly sixty singles before the label’s final release, the perhaps appropriately-titled "Feel Like Givin’ Up" by Posse, in February 1972. The label was dissolved in 1974.
